Output 6baaeb520da928c619658aab69e7b664d01e1cdb1ec1a0aab891e31f18261a27:1

value
434870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8063f36be943f87570dd9432c8c140292b420c4 OP_EQUAL
address
3H1SvpFcjgtVwTmZ68rSfm23oXuweEEbsS
transaction
6baaeb520da928c619658aab69e7b664d01e1cdb1ec1a0aab891e31f18261a27
spent
true